How was Return of the Jedi supposed to end?

At the conclusion of the 1983 film, the young Jedi Luke Skywalker resists the temptation of the Dark Side and helps to defeat the Galactic Empire. Luke bests his father, Darth Vader, in combat, and then spares his life, which leads the Sith Lord to perform an act of redemption by saving his son from Emperor Palpatine.

How does Anakin appear at the end of Return of the Jedi?

Sebastian Shaw played an older version of Anakin, aka Darth Vader, when he was unmasked in Return of the Jedi. In Return of the Jedi’s end scene, Anakin’s so-called “Force ghost” appears alongside Obi-Wan Kenobi and Yoda, and that’s where the debate comes into play.

Why was Revenge of the Jedi changed to Return of the Jedi?

But Lucas realized a Jedi technically doesn’t seek revenge in the mythology he created, so the title was changed back to Return of the Jedi before the movie opened on May 25, 1983. Lucas eventually used the “Revenge of” naming convention on the third prequel in the saga, 2005’s Revenge of the Sith.

Did they add Hayden Christensen to Return of the Jedi?

A CGI shot of the planet Naboo, from the prequel trilogy, has been inserted in between the 1997 Special Edition shots of Tatooine and Coruscant. In the 2004 DVD release of Return of the Jedi, the ghostly image of Sebastian Shaw as Anakin Skywalker is replaced with Hayden Christensen.

Why did Anakin become a ghost?

As Qui-Gon Jinn said to Yoda in the ROTS novel,it’s a state that’s attained through selflessness as opposed to selfishness,compassion instead of passion. The moment Anakin chose to save his son from Palpatine,he showed both compassion and selflessness. That’s how he became a Force ghost.
